Q: Is there a way to ban IP addresses?

Is there a way to ban the IP so that the same spammer is not eating all my credits? I don't see the point in keeping this application if there is no way to completely ban repeat offenders

asakhaiasakhai
asakhaiPLUS

Verified purchaser

Founder Team
Oumkaltoum_cloudfilt

Oumkaltoum_cloudfilt

Sep 24, 2025

A: Yes, you can block IP addresses to prevent repeat offenders from consuming your credits. Here’s how:

1. Go to your list of websites via https://app.cloudfilt.com/websites.
2. Select the desired site, click Settings, then Configure CloudFilt.
3. In the Blacklisting section, you can block IPs, hosts, ASNs, or countries as needed.

Q: CloudFilt Disconnects my sites from ManageWP

I noticed all my websites that use CloudFilt WAF can't connect to my ManageWP dashboard any longer. I'm assuming I have to do some type of configuration within CloudFilt to reconnect them? How do I fix this?

A: Hello, To restore the connection between your sites and ManageWP, add ManageWP’s IP addresses to CloudFilt’s whitelist by following these steps:

1. Log in to your CloudFilt dashboard.
2. Go to Websites & Web Apps > My Websites.
3. Select the relevant site.
4. Click on Settings, then Configure CloudFilt.
